Endovascular repair of common celiomesenteric trunk stenosis

2010 
A common celiomesenteric trunk (CMT) is one of the several anatomic variations in the mesenteric circulation and occurs when the celiac and superior mesenteric arteries originate from a single common trunk. Because of its rarity, few lesions of the CMT have been reported. We herein present a case of atherosclerotic stenosis of the CMT of an 81-year-old female who presented with symptoms of mesenteric angina. To our knowledge, this represents the first reported case of endovascular treatment of CMT stenosis.
